"Greetings! I am home from Wound Care.
I had an X-Ray done with 3 views of the Right Foot.
The Phalanx Bone will have to be removed.

![image.png](https://files.peakd.com/file/peakd-hive/jerrytsuseer/23ydV5bYfcnu2mXEGdMKMxpdtgEvCTzB8ZDtQo4KkHPZuignpH5o7quR3NxqMUHiWWTvM.png)

Foot surgery #2 is in the works for next week.
Not sure if it will be outpatient or an overnight stay.

![image.png](https://files.peakd.com/file/peakd-hive/jerrytsuseer/23xATKFGzuQ9CBsqAfeLeBZiuaYHwwVvoqCeC9gmB3kH6YBFoxS6AMDirybb8JBMMNTMn.png) **↑before↑**
I am currently cast free for a few days and then when surgery is completed, I will be casted again.

It is the right way to go and will totally clear up the wound and osteomyelitis that is in that bone.
Conventional IV Antibiotic Therapy will not clear the infection up.

There you have it folks. Fun, Fun, Fun. No, I am not in any pain just sore from the debridement of the wound bed.
